Na serwerze
Aby zaprogramować i odpowiednio udokumentować aplikację serwerową, musimy dysponować środowiskiem programistycznym wyposażonym w poniższe narzędzia.
1. Interpreter języka Ruby
Najprościej i niemal najwygodniej jest uzyskać go dzięki instalacji Ruby Version Manager.
W pierwszym kroku pobieramy odpowiednie klucze GPG.
gp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DBW drugim i ostatnim, pobieramy skrypt instalacyjny i przekazujemy go do powłoki.
curl -sSL https://get.rvm.io | bash -s stable[info] Wskazówka
Jeśli druga podana komenda nie działa, a masz pewność, że siedzisz przed maszyną z systemem Linux, najpewniej nie jest na niej zainstalowany program curl. Rozwiązaniem będzie zainstalowanie go. To ważne, aby umieć instalować programy w systemie operacyjnym, z którego korzystamy.
2. Framework Ruby on Rails
Który najłatwiej jest zainstalować razem z RVM, do komendy dodając flagę --rails
curl -sSL https://get.rvm.io | bash -s stable --rails3. Graphviz
Graphviz to dostępne w każdym menadżerze paczek narzędzie do rysowania grafów. Przyda nam się przy generowaniu wykresów. Zainstalujesz go tak samo jak curl, czy jakiekolwiek inne narzędzie wiersza poleceń. Przykładowo, dla systemu Debian, korzystamy z apt.
sudo apt install graphviz4. Edytor kodu
W wypadku którego wygodnym i darmowym rozwiązaniem będzie Atom.
Last updated